The look and the feel

The Ritz-Carlton

The Ritz-Carlton occupies a former Maison Blanche department store on Canal Street, a 1908 Beaux-Arts building with a cast-iron and terracotta facade, kept largely intact when it was converted into a hotel in the early 2000s. Inside, the public rooms lean on the building's bones: high ceilings, restrained gilt, marble underfoot, and a lobby that still feels institutional in a good way, more bank than boutique. The Davenport Lounge draws an older, dressed-up crowd for the jazz sets, and the 25,000-square-foot spa is a genuine draw rather than a token gesture. It suits a guest who wants Canal Street grandeur and doesn't mind paying for it.

Guests who want a grand, old-New-Orleans hotel experience with a proper spa and live jazz, and who are willing to pay for it.

Kimpton Hotel Fontenot by IHG

The listing gives less to go on: Kimpton's house style elsewhere runs to bold colour, mixed-pattern textiles and a loose, unstuffy lobby with a shared lounge and free bikes at the door, and the Fontenot's amenities (fitness centre, restaurant, communal spaces) fit that pattern, though the specifics of this property's decor aren't detailed in the material provided. Its address near Tchoupitoulas and Poydras puts it closer to the Convention Center and the edge of the Warehouse District rather than the Canal Street tourist corridor, a slightly less monumental, more workaday stretch of downtown.

Guests who want a well-rated, contemporary stay near the Convention Center without the five-star price tag.

At $343 the Fontenot gives up the spa, the pool and the hot tub that the Ritz-Carlton offers, so anyone wanting a full spa day or a swim needs to look elsewhere or pay the difference.

The Ritz-Carlton is the more beautiful building to stand inside, a converted department store with real architectural weight, though the Fontenot likely has the livelier, more contemporary energy of the two.
